“You’ll Face Tough And Likely Dirty Campaign” – Obasanjo Warns Atiku

Former President Olusegun Obasanjo has warned the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) presidential candidate, Alhaji Atiku Abubakar to be prepared for the “tough and likey dirty campaigns” ahead 2019 general elections.

Obasanjo, who however noted that Atiku Abubakar was the only one among the PDP aspirants who has the capacity to perform better than the incumbent President Muhammadu Buhari, said he already know how to “handle what is already out and what may yet be put out by the opposition”.

The former President spoke on Thursday when he played host to former Vice-President Atiku Abubakar, as well as received religious leaders, top politicians and civil rights activists who accompanied the PDP candidate on the visit designed to reconcile Atiku with his former boss.

Speaking during the visit, Obasanjo said:  “For me, relatively and of all the aspirants in the PDP, you have the widest and greatest exposure, experience, outreach and possibly the best machinery and preparation for seeing the tough and likely dirty campaign ahead through. From what I personally know of you, you have capacity to perform better than the incumbent. You surely understand the economy better; you have business experience, which can make your administration business-friendly and boost the economy and provide jobs.

Obasanjo alluded to the fact that Atiku was opposite of the incumbent ostensibly because; “You have better outreach nationally and internationally and that can translate to better management of foreign affairs. You are more accessible and less inflexible and more open to all parts of the country in many ways. As Pastor Bakare, one-time running mate of the incumbent President said, “You are a wazobia man.” And that should help you in confronting the confrontable and shunning nepotism.”

Obasanjo advised Abubakar to team up with those who lost out in the race to secure the presidential ticket of the PDP.

“In addition to appreciating all that the Party has done for you, may I advise you to work together with all those who contested for the party’s flag with you as a team for your campaign,” he said.

BigPen Online recalls that Obasanjo had purportedly nursed resentment for Atiku over the years after the latter reportedly scuttled his third term bid but the former vice president was quoted to have said some time ago that he has no problems with Obasanjo but is not sure if the former President and Head of State has a problem with him.

But speaking further however, Obasanjo who said he had forgiven Atiku during the meeting maintained: “There are still areas, nationally and internationally, where you have to mend fences and make amends. You will know how to handle what is already out and what may yet be put out by the opposition”.

He said that the coast would be clear for Atiku nationally and Internationally if he continue to mend fences and make amends ahead 2019.

“But, I am convinced that if you continue with the attitude that brought you here with these distinguished leaders of goodwill, with remorse and contrite heart, the rest of the coast within and outside the country can be cleared. And if there is anything I can do and you want me to do in that respect, I will do.

“I am sure with the right attitude for change where necessary, and by putting lessons learned by you to work, you will get the understanding, cooperation, support and mandate – all at the national level.

“With Nigerians voting for you, it will mean that you secure their forgiveness and regain their confidence. It will be with the hope or assurance of a Paul on the road to Damascus Conversion. After all, change and conversion are of man. I believe that with a contrite heart, change is possible in everybody’s life and situation.”
